7 Photos of the Week: Key Events Across the Valley

Kathmandu. Various events unfolded in the valley over the past week.

From those events, Ratopati presents 7 photos in its '7 Photos of the Week' column.

Following the Supreme Court's verdict, ripples were created within the Congress party. This week, Home Minister Sudhan Gurung resigned, and bulldozers were also deployed in the squatter settlement.
